The largest nearby commercial center is Ellsworth - often referred to as the gateway city to Down East Maine. There you will find many large and small businesses as well as a U.S. Post Office, Banks, and a hospital. Mount Desert Island is about 2 miles away where the majority of Acadia National Park lies including the Visitor Center in Hulls Cove, just off Route 3 in Bar Harbor.

The ISLAND EXPLORER is a free shuttle bus that takes people wherever they want to go. Additionally they have designated stops and schedules that allow people to leave their cars at any of the terminals and travel freely. The bus also has capacity to carry bikes. LL Bean is the major sponsor of this free shuttle. There is a scheduled stop just 5 minutes from the house at Trenton Marketplace on Rt. 3.
